What Is the Typical Lifespan of Asphalt Shingles?
The lifespan of asphalt shingles can vary significantly based on material quality, installation, weather exposure, and maintenance practices. That said, most asphalt shingles are designed to last between 15 and 30 years, with some premium options pushing past the 30-year mark under ideal conditions.
Understanding what “typical” really means requires looking at the most common types of asphalt shingles on the market—and how they tend to perform over time.

3-Tab vs. Architectural Shingles
Asphalt shingles come in a few varieties, but the two most widely used are 3-tab and architectural shingles (also known as dimensional or laminate) shingles. Each has its own expected service life:
- 3-Tab Shingles:
These are the most budget-friendly and have a flat, uniform appearance. Their typical lifespan ranges from 15 to 20 years, depending on installation and environmental conditions. Because they’re lighter and thinner, they’re more vulnerable to wind damage and granule loss over time. - Architectural Shingles:
Thicker and more durable, architectural shingles offer better protection and a layered, textured look. On average, they last 20 to 30 years, and many are designed to resist high winds and extreme temperatures better than 3-tab options.
While both types can perform well with proper care, architectural shingles generally provide better long-term value, especially in regions prone to storms or intense sun exposure.

Manufacturer Warranties vs. Real-World Lifespan
Shingle packaging often promotes warranties of 25, 30, or even 50 years, but it’s important to understand that these warranties are not a direct reflection of how long the shingles will actually last on your roof.
- Warranties typically cover manufacturing defects, not natural wear and tear.
- The actual service life depends on installation quality, climate, and how well the roof is maintained.
- In practice, a shingle with a 30-year warranty may need replacing around the 20- to 25-year mark due to weather exposure and aging.
Think of warranties as a benchmark for product confidence—not a guaranteed lifespan.
Takeaway: While manufacturer warranties may promise decades of protection, the true asphalt shingle lifespan usually falls between 15 and 30 years, depending on the shingle type and how well it’s installed and maintained.
Key Factors That Impact Shingle Lifespan
Even the highest-rated asphalt shingles won’t reach their full lifespan without the right conditions. While the average range for asphalt shingle lifespan falls between 15 and 30 years, several key variables can shift that timeline significantly—either shortening it or extending it with proper care and quality decisions.
Understanding these factors helps property owners make informed choices and avoid premature roof failure.

Climate and Weather Extremes
Weather is one of the most influential forces acting on a shingle roof over time. Repeated exposure to intense sunlight, heavy rain, snow, hail, and high winds causes materials to expand, contract, erode, or even tear away entirely.
- UV radiation can dry out shingles, causing cracking and brittleness.
- Heavy winds and storms may loosen or dislodge shingles altogether.
- Frequent freeze-thaw cycles (in colder regions) stress the roofing structure.
- Moisture retention from rain or snow can promote algae growth or rot if not drained properly.
These environmental pressures gradually degrade shingle performance, accelerating wear and reducing their effective service life. Roof Waterproofing and Roof Drainage Solutions can be valuable preventive measures in such climates.

Installation Quality and Roof Design
Even top-tier shingles will underperform if installed improperly. A well-installed roof isn’t just about nailing shingles in place—it includes proper flashing, ventilation, and alignment with manufacturer specifications.
- Roof pitch (slope) influences water runoff. Steeper roofs generally shed water more efficiently, which can extend the lifespan of shingles.
- Ventilation is critical. Without it, heat and moisture can build up in the attic, leading to premature shingle degradation from underneath. Proper roof ventilation plays a major role here.
- Underlayment and flashing provide additional layers of protection. Skipping or using subpar materials at this level weakens the overall system.
Hiring experienced, certified contractors who follow best practices can make the difference between a 15-year roof and a 25-year one.

Material Quality and Brand Differences
Not all asphalt shingles are created equal. Manufacturer differences in materials, adhesives, granule coatings, and design structure play a direct role in how long a shingle lasts.
- Economy-grade shingles tend to have thinner mats and lower granule coverage, which makes them more susceptible to damage and aging.
- Premium shingles often come with reinforced backing, impact-resistant features, and better granule adhesion for long-term performance.
Choosing reputable, high-quality brands—ideally those with strong customer reviews and long-standing reputations—can increase the chance that your roof meets or exceeds its expected service life.

Roof Maintenance Habits
While maintenance doesn’t guarantee longevity, it plays a significant role in preserving the integrity of your roof. Neglected debris, clogged gutters, or unnoticed damage can lead to water intrusion or hidden structural issues that drastically shorten shingle life.
Even simple preventive actions—like spotting missing granules or cracked shingles early—can delay costly repairs or full replacements
Takeaway: The true longevity of your asphalt shingles depends not just on the product, but on how it’s installed, maintained, and protected against the elements. Paying attention to these key factors can add years to your roof’s service life.

How to Recognize Signs of Aging Shingles
Asphalt shingles don’t fail all at once—they wear down gradually, showing visible and sometimes subtle signs of deterioration along the way. Knowing what to look for can help you spot problems early, avoid emergency repairs, and plan for a timely replacement before serious damage occurs.
You can also review the 3 stages of asphalt shingle deterioration to better understand how wear and aging progress over time.
Here are the most common warning signs that your shingles—and possibly your entire roof—are nearing the end of their service life:
Cracking, Curling, or Missing Shingles
When shingles begin to crack or curl at the edges, it’s usually a sign of prolonged exposure to the sun, wind, and fluctuating temperatures. Curling also suggests potential moisture problems underneath the surface.
- Cracked shingles compromise the waterproof barrier and may allow leaks.
- Curling edges can catch wind more easily, increasing the chance of blow-offs.
- Missing shingles are a clear red flag. If entire tabs are torn off, the roof is exposed to direct water intrusion.
Granule Loss (Especially in Gutters)
One of the earliest signs of asphalt shingle degradation is granule shedding—the tiny, sand-like particles on the surface that protect the shingles from UV damage and improve fire resistance.
You may notice:
- Smooth or shiny spots on individual shingles
- Dark granules accumulating in gutters or at the base of downspouts
- A more faded appearance across large areas of the roof
Example: After a heavy summer thunderstorm, a Florida homeowner cleans their gutters and notices a thick layer of gritty debris. Upon closer inspection, they find that several shingles above the area are noticeably smoother and starting to discolor—an early sign that the roof is losing its protective layer.
Discoloration or Dark Streaks
While some staining is caused by algae or environmental pollutants, dark streaks and patchy discoloration can also signal water absorption, trapped moisture, or uneven weathering—all signs that shingles are aging and may not be performing as they should.
Sagging or Leaks in the Attic
Visible sagging of the roofline or signs of water intrusion in the attic—like damp insulation, water stains, or a musty smell—often indicate advanced roof failure. You can learn more about what causes a sagging roof and what steps may be needed to address it.
At this stage, it’s likely that the shingles, underlayment, and possibly structural decking have all been compromised. This could call for a thorough roof inspection to determine the extent of the issue.
Takeaway: From curling edges to granules in your gutters, aging shingles leave clues behind. Recognizing these early signs can help you act before small problems become costly repairs—and ensure your roof stays protective and reliable.

When to Repair vs. Replace Asphalt Shingles
Asphalt shingles naturally degrade over time—but deciding whether to repair a damaged section or invest in a full residential roof replacement isn’t always straightforward. It depends on the severity of the damage, the age of the roof, and your long-term plans for the property. Making the right call can save you money, extend the roof’s life, and prevent structural headaches down the line.
Cost-Benefit Analysis: Patch vs. Total Replacement
A small area of missing or curled shingles might be easily repaired. But when issues are widespread—or repairs become frequent—patching may only delay the inevitable.
Repair may be sufficient when:
- Damage is localized (e.g., after a single storm event)
- Shingles are still within their expected service life
- The underlayment and decking remain intact
Replacement is usually the smarter choice when:
- You’re facing repeated leaks or frequent spot repairs
- Multiple areas of the roof show signs of advanced aging
- Repairs exceed 25–30% of the total roof surface
Investing in a full replacement can be more cost-effective over time, especially if your roof is approaching the end of its expected lifespan.
Age of the Roof vs. Overall Condition
Shingle roofs don’t expire on a specific date—but age is still a critical factor. If your roof is nearing 20 to 25 years old, even minor issues could be a sign that bigger problems are on the horizon.
Ask yourself:
- Has the roof been maintained consistently?
- Are the aging signs (e.g., curling, cracking, granule loss) isolated or widespread?
- Does the roof still look flat and uniform, or does it show uneven sagging or wear?
If the roof is relatively young and the damage is minor, repair may extend its life. But an older roof showing multiple signs of deterioration is often better replaced to avoid escalating costs.
Signs of Systemic Failure
Some damage points to deeper issues that can’t be fixed with surface-level repairs. These include:
- Widespread leaks or moisture infiltration
- Mold or rot in the attic
- Sagging roof lines
- Significant granule loss across the entire roof
At this stage, repairs become a temporary fix. A new roofing system—complete with proper ventilation, underlayment, and roof restoration—is typically the safest long-term solution.
